Honestly, the stealth segments aren't as bad as some would make you think. It's just an off mechanic for a game that is a God Of War clone (and as a side note the stealth issue that all the reviews complained about makes no sense to me...got through it very quickly). Imagine eating a fast food meal and then instead of fries you get a side of brussels sprouts. The problem I had is that the tone of the whole game feels off: in the first half your basically a super weak vampire with emotional problems running around a generic city. Enemies are also a bit sparse and (bosses aside) have very generic designs. They look like they were pulled straight from that recent Splatterhouse remake.

I wrapped it up last night. I will say that the second half and conclusion are much better than the initial 5 hours. But still, don't make the mistake I made and purchase this at full retail. It's a $20 buy for sure.
